Muse to start recording new album in May

In an interview, during their Coachella headlining spot last weekend, Muse unveiled their plans to start working on the follow-up to their sixth album ("The 2nd Law") very soon, in May.

Drummer Dom Howard explained: "We're going to start this year... (Coachella) is our last two gigs, then we're completely done for touring this album. We're going to go back in May and start working on some new stuff, so I think we'll start making it this year... If we can get something out this year, that would be great, but definitely next year".

Matt Bellamy also said that he has already written new material, commenting: "I've written some good tracks, actually. We haven't had a chance to rehearse them out yet... I have this strong feeling that the next album should be something that really does strip away the additional things that we've experimented with on the last two albums, which is electronics, symphonics and orchestral work and all that kind of stuff".
